Abstract

Rice bran is a feed ingredient as a result of the rice milling process which widely used as an energy source in the feed formulation in the chicken diet. Rice bran reported containing various nutrients such as oil, protein, carbohydrates (especially starch), beta-glucans, and pectins. Rice bran contains bioactive compounds that have positive effects on the chicken performance and health. Recently, bioactive compounds from rice bran have been developing as a source of making functional feed. The objective of this study was to review the bioactive compounds in rice bran and their benefits in order to produce functional feed for chicken. The results of the study showed that rice bran contains hundreds of bioactive components. The most important bioactive were tocopherols, tocotrienols, and oryzanols. This components have high antioxidant activity compared to other components. Lysolecithin from rice bran has ability on lowering cholesterol in blood, meat and chicken of eggs. Furthermore, rice bran extract reported has antibacterial properties. Besides, bioactive compounds of rice bran has function as immunomodulator. It can be concluded that the bioactive compounds of rice bran potentially used as raw materials for making functional feed for chickens.
